Transaction 0de51dbbf5e3af7b626ea26539621fff169d1338a1c30d84c91bc698c6321eff
1 Input
1 Output
-
0de51dbbf5e3af7b626ea26539621fff169d1338a1c30d84c91bc698c6321eff:0
- value
- 104316
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b8c5257e531614dad46cc934c36f75f25fa944b OP_EQUAL
- address
- 34CgGSd9ZZnMc86JWSneubkurQLLTpoNLo